Daniel J. Hamel, of Salisbury, MA, passed away peacefully on November 25, 2025, surrounded by his family, after a long battle with Alzheimer's Disease.
Born in Lawrence, MA, on September 23, 1945, Dan was the son of the late Lionel and Helen (Graney) Hamel and the older brother of the late Michael Hamel. He graduated from Central Catholic High School in 1963 and from UMass Amherst in 1967. Dan began his career as a high school history teacher in Hyde Park, NY, working with a group he fondly referred to as the "original sweathogs."
After marrying his loving wife, Jean (Courtemanche)-with whom he celebrated 57 years of marriage-Dan transitioned into what became a successful 35+ year career in technology. Supported by postgraduate studies at the University of Virginia and Harvard University, along with an MBA from Northeastern, he rose quickly through the ranks. He spent more than 25 years helping lead Digital Equipment Corporation as Vice President and General Manager, and later served as CIO of Hughes Network Systems in Gaithersburg, MD-a role his children found ironic, as he frequently asked for help simply turning on the computer or as he referred to it "the system." Despite any perceived "technology challenges," Dan's real gift was leadership; he built teams rooted in loyalty, camaraderie, and lifelong friendship.
Although work took him around the globe, Dan and Jean ultimately settled for more than two decades in Westford, MA, while spending every summer at their beloved Salisbury beach house. After retiring early, they divided their time between their family compound in Salisbury and their home in Summerfield, FL, where these self-proclaimed "active adults" filled their days with golf, bocce, trivia nights, and dancing to live music in the town square.
Behind Dan's stoic demeanor was a man who loved watching the Red Sox and Patriots, playing 45's, drinking beer out of a wine glass, monitoring the stock market ticker, and spinning tales of days gone by to the great delight of his grandchildren.
